In this paper we describe the (annotation) tools underlying two automatic techniques to analyse the meaning and use of backward causal connectives in large Dutch newspaper corpora. With the help of these techniques, Latent Semantic Analysis and Thematic Text Analysis, the contexts of more than 14,000 connectives were studied. We will focus here on the methods of analysis and on the fairly straightforward (annotation) tools needed to perform the semantic analyses, i.e. POS-tagging, lemmatisation and a thesaurus-like thematic dictionary.
